3 stars Classic Yes line up minus Chris Squire. And Squire was sorely missing here. Ok, Tony Levin is a master of the instrument, but we are talking about (musical) chemistry. Frankly, I was losing my patience with Yes at the time. After a string of essential, strong, classic prog albums in the 70īs, their output in the 80īs was uneven, to say the least. And this album wasnīt going to save them, even if it is far better than most of what they have done a few years before.

What Yes fan wouldnīt want Bruford back to the drums stool? I miss Squireīs trademark bass lines, but you canīt have everythig and I could deal with that. The main problem here is the lack of inspiration, specially at the songwriting department. The strongest cuts are the the first three and I remember thinking how good they were, giving me hoep that they finally made an album worth of their historical importance. However, from the middle to the end they were running out of ideas (or so it seemed) and the LP simply dragged on. Quite the pattern for some of their future releases, I must admit. Their great muscianship could not hide some of the songīs weakness. Still, they at least delivered some good stuff if you donīt try to compare this album to their classics of the 70īs. So my rating would be something between 2,5 to 3 stars. Mostly for fans, but still good enough for the occasional listener.
